Transaction 5857121633c36aef7621b3c27ea03917b54adb7bd912c5e15b2aa86b5050aaa4

1 Input
2 Outputs
  • 5857121633c36aef7621b3c27ea03917b54adb7bd912c5e15b2aa86b5050aaa4:0
  • value  4970000
    address  3PzkTxVDRtYsZgy8sZzYVG4h1Nr72Qcw7M
  • 5857121633c36aef7621b3c27ea03917b54adb7bd912c5e15b2aa86b5050aaa4:1
  • value  3367684
    address  1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